Latest in Gaming

Image credit:

Come and get your Madden 08 demo

Dustin Burg

Patiently awaiting your download this morning is a brand new Madden NFL 08 demo on the Xbox Live Marketplace. The demo weighs in at a nice 813MB and is available to North American as well as most European Xbox Live members. We aren't sure how long the demo lasts or what teams you get to play as since the description for the demo only reads "Download the demo.", so you'll have to feel this one out for yourself. Cue up Madden 08 for download fanboys, we know you're curious to see what EA has done with the series this year.

From around the web

ear iconeye icontext filevr